DC75957 BAS-118
BAS-118 is a benzamide derivative with antibacterial activity. The MIC50, MIC90 and MIC ranges of BAS-118 for 100 randomly selected isolates of Helicobacter pylori are ≤0.003, 0.013 and ≤0.003-0.025 mg/L, respectively. BAS-118 is promising for research of anti-H. pylori agent.

DC75956 BAR-072
BAR-072 is a small-molecule inhibitor targeting TraE, with a KD of 2.7 µM. It significantly inhibits the transfer of the antibiotic resistance-associated plasmid pKM101. BAR-072 shows promise as a candidate compound for blocking the spread of bacterial resistance genes and holds potential for research in infectious disease and antimicrobial resistance control.

DC75949 Antibacterial synergist 3
Antibacterial synergist 3 is a dual-acting inhibitor of biofilm (IC50 of PAO1: 0.40 μM and IC50 of PA14: 1.45 μM). Antibacterial synergist 3 reduces virulence production by inhibiting the quorum sensing (QS) system and induces iron deficiency in P. aeruginosa PAO1. Antibacterial synergist 3 enhances the efficacy of Tobramycin and Ciprofloxacin in a mouse wound infection model. Antibacterial synergist 3 can be used for the research of P. aeruginosa infections.

DC75944 AK-968-11563024
AK-968-11563024 is an inhibitor of marine V. vulnificus NAT [ (VIBVN)NAT] with an IC50 of 18.86 µM. NATs (Arylamine N-acetyltransferases) in marine V. vulnificus plays a role in drug metabolism, contributing to the development of drug resistance. Therefore, AK-968-11563024 can be utilized in research related to drug resistance.

DC75934 (-)-Luteoskyrin
(-)-Luteoskyrin has a wide range of antibacterial activity, such as against malaria (with an IC50 of 0.51 μg/mL), tuberculosis (MIC of 6.25 μg/mL), and it also shows antibacterial effects (with MIC for Gram-positive bacteria ranging from 0.39 to 1.56 μg/mL, and for Gram-negative bacteria from 3.13 to 12.50 μg/mL), as well as antifungal activity (with MIC against plant pathogens ranging from 3.13 to 50μg/mL). (-)-Luteoskyrin exhibits cytotoxicity against NCI-H187 cells, with an IC50 range of 0.16–17.99 μg/mL.

DC70512 IODVA1 Featured
IODVA1 is a small molecule with cellular inhibitory activity against several transformed cell lines including Ras-driven cells, targets Rac activation and signaling instead of Ras; IODVA1 inhibits ST8814 cell proliferation with GI50 of 1 uM, similar results were observed with MCF7, MDA-MB-231, and T47D cells with estimated GI50s <1 uM. IODVA1 significantly decreases number of colonies of the breast cancer cells in soft agar at 1 and 3 uM. IODVA1 probably does not bind Ras and that its mechanism of action is likely Ras-independent, inhibits lamellipodia and circular dorsal ruffle (CDR) formation in MDA-MB-231 cells and decreases Rac activation. IODVA1 inhibits Rac activation and downstream signaling leading to inhibition of lamellipodia and CDR formation; IODVA1 inhibits cell-substratum and cell-cell interactions, does not target kinases, and reduces tumor burden of solid tumors in vivo.
